Background and objective: The aim of this study was to evaluate the diagnostic utility of lung‐specific X protein (LUNX) mRNA expression in bronchial brushing specimens from patients with lung cancer.
Methods: LUNX mRNA levels were assessed by performing RT‐PCR on liquid‐based cytology bronchial brushing specimens from patients with lung cancer (n = 104) or benign lung disease (n = 91).
